ABOUT INUVIALUIT REGIONAL CORPORATION (IRC)


IRC was created in 1984 to represent the Inuvialuit and their rights and benefits obtained under one of Canadas oldest comprehensive land claim agreements. With assets over $1 billion not including vast land holdings IRC is responsible for corporate investment land management and a broad range of social cultural and economic programs and services benefiting Inuvialuit. Its subsidiaries have interests in grocery manufacturing property management transportation and significant dealings in the oil and gas industry.

Since its inception IRC has experienced considerable growth and its structure and operations have become increasingly complex. Combining local government and service delivery community development investment and operating business divisions all managed by a single back office the organization has an array of complexities for the executive staff to navigate. ABOUT MAMAQTUQ RESTAURANT LTD.


Mamaqtuq Restaurant is one of IRCs flagship ventures offering a unique dining experience that blends traditional Inuvialuit flavors with contemporary cuisine. Learn more: SUMMARY


Servers are key in ensuring guests enjoy a welcoming and memorable dining experience by delivering outstanding service. Responsibilities include taking orders providing personalized service maintaining a clean dining environment and supporting front-of-house operations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Greet guests warmly and manage seating and waitlists.
  • Provide attentive service to guests accurately presenting menu options and offering recommendations.
  • Ensure order accuracy and address any guest inquiries promptly.
  • Collaborate with kitchen staff to ensure timely delivery of food and beverages.
  • Maintain a clean and organized dining area to uphold the restaurants reputation for quality.
  • Operate the point-of-sale (POS) system to process orders and payment.
  • Assist with reservations and efficiently coordinate seating arrangements.
  • Monitor the dining area to ensure tables are ready and available for guests.
  • Communicate with team members to ensure smooth service.
  • Respond to guest inquiries regarding reservations and restaurant policies.
  • Follow health and safety rules.
